Here is a list of parts you will need.
-6(maybe more depending on where you decide to mount them) Off in resting position magnetic switches.
-A butt load of wire
-27 diodes
-7 5200ohm resistors
-PC board
-Enclosure box
-2 female 9 pin connectors
-2 male 9 pin connectors
-solder
-15watt iron w/ very small tip
-very good soldering skills
-several burns and curse words
this circuit needs to be made VERY small so you can hide it in enclosure and hide it under the cup holder/shifter area.
